UD Almería to kick off Spanish Cup journey at 9pm on Wednesday, 30 October

UD San ​​Sebastián de los Reyes will host the Rojiblancos in the first round of the exciting Spanish tournament. The Indálicos have to play 5 games in a fortnight

UD Almería kick off the Spanish Cup first round, which is played in a single-legged tie, at 9pm (Spanish Time) on Wednesday, 30th October. UD San ​​Sebastián de los Reyes, a team from Madrid that compete in the Group V of the fourth-tier Segunda RFEF tier, will host the Rojiblancos. 
 
This has been determined by the RFEF, which has announced the dates and kick-off times of this first round. Once the Cup tie has been confirmed, UD Almería are gearing up ahead of a packed schedule, since as there is also a week-day league fixture, the Rojiblancos will have to play 5 games in a fortnight. 
 
The first match will be held on Sunday, 20th October in Zaragoza (KO 6:30pm). After, they will host Albacete Balompié on Thursday, 24th October for a 7pm kick off and on 27th October, a new encounter will take place in Huesca (KO 6:30pm). Without any break, the Spanish Cup tie against Sanse takes place on Wednesday, 30th October. 
 
The second week of this football 'marathon' ends on Sunday, 3rd November with the LaLiga Hypermotion match that the Indálicos will play at home against Córdoba CF (Matchday 13).
